With the advancement of metro construction,the structure forms of metro stations and linking tunnels have much varied. The sizes of them become increasingly larger;Complicated geologies and existing buildings have beenrepeatedly encountered in the process of metro construction,so construction technologies has correspondingly gained much progress,and have been innovated,in which many new construction methods have been successfully implemented in situ. The cavern-pile method for shallow buried underground excavated tunnels is one of them. Combining the advantages of the traditional shallow buried underground and partial excavation method with the characteristic of reverse construction method,the cavern-pile method exhibits higher flexibility and wider adaptability. Successful application to many station jobsites of the Fu-Ba line of Beijing metro program shows that using the cavern-pile method in loose soft stratum for excavating shallow buried large section tunnels is practicable. Therefore it has broad prospect for application. And it is worth much promotion. But current theoretical analysis on the method is not adequate,its mechanism and constraints of application are not yet fully understood,which may hinder the step of further use and promotion in the underground engineering. Considering the above reason,this paper,by the action-reaction model in the design theory of underground structure,and by FEM,establishes an analysis frame based on the characteristics of the cavern-pile method. The influences of tunnel span,height,overburden depth,and excavation sequence on the cavern-pile method are discussed by a careful interpretation of the modeling result. In addition,acomparison of surface settlement and engineering quantity of the cavern-pile method with those of the binocular excavation method,bench cut method and CD method are made in the paper. The research is meaningful in theory for further application and promoting the cavern-pile method.
